Remember that Shaws radio advert back in the day? ‘Shaws! Almost nationwide!’In some typical Irish banter with friends, we en-acted the scenario of a Carlovian emigrant eager to know about things back home: ‘tell me this....did Shaws ever make it nationwide?’
Many Carlovians have grown up with Shaws department store at the heart of their shopping experience. A family owned business in its fourth generation, since Henry Shaw first opened its doors in 1864, it seems they have indeed ‘made it nationwide’, with stores in 16 locations across Ireland.
The new tag line for adverts: ‘Shaws, your complete department store!’
Shaws Carlow have traditionally featured the work of a local artist during Carlow Arts Festival in June and this year, I'm delighted to have my work featured in their windows.
As you stroll through Tullow Street, watch out for a sample of my paintings from ‘The Sacred Lives of Trees’ collection, along with a selection of my limited edition prints.
